PSP games played a crucial role in shaping portable gaming by introducing console-level experiences in a handheld format. The PlayStation Portable allowed players to enjoy RPGs, action games, and immersive adventures on the go, which was a major innovation in gaming history. This helped redefine expectations for handheld systems and influenced future hybrid devices that combine portability with console-quality performance. PSP games remain culturally significant because they proved that portable gaming could deliver depth and quality comparable to home Console games, even with hardware limitations.
